# mini-css-extract-plugin
This plugin extracts CSS into separate files. It creates a CSS file per JS file which contains CSS. It supports On-Demand-Loading of CSS and SourceMaps.
It builds on top of a new webpack v4 feature (module types) and requires webpack 4 to work.
Compared to the extract-text-webpack-plugin:
- Async loading
- No duplicate compilation (performance)
- Easier to use
- Specific to CSS
## Getting Started
To begin, you'll need to install `mini-css-extract-plugin`:
```bash
npm install --save-dev mini-css-extract-plugin
```
It's recommended to combine `mini-css-extract-plugin` with the [`css-loader`](https://github.com/webpack-contrib/css-loader)
Then add the loader and the plugin to your `webpack` config. For example:
**style.css**
```css
body {
background: green;
}
```
**component.js**
```js
import './style.css';
```
**webpack.config.js**
```js
const MiniCssExtractPlugin = require('mini-css-extract-plugin');
module.exports = {
plugins: [new MiniCssExtractPlugin()],
module: {
rules: [
{
test: /\.css$/i,
use: [MiniCssExtractPlugin.loader, 'css-loader'],
},
],
},
};
```
## Options
### Plugin Options
| Name | Type | Default | Description |
| :-----------------------------------: | :------------------: | :-----------------------------------: | :--------------------------------------------------------- |
| **[`filename`](#filename)** | `{String\|Function}` | `[name].css` | This option determines the name of each output CSS file |
| **[`chunkFilename`](#chunkFilename)** | `{String\|Function}` | `based on filename` | This option determines the name of non-entry chunk files |
| **[`ignoreOrder`](#ignoreOrder)** | `{Boolean}` | `false` | Remove Order Warnings |
| **[`insert`](#insert)** | `{String\|Function}` | `document.head.appendChild(linkTag);` | Inserts `<link>` at the given position |
| **[`attributes`](#attributes)** | `{Object}` | `{}` | Adds custom attributes to tag |
| **[`linkType`](#linkType)** | `{String\|Boolean}` | `text/css` | Allows loading asynchronous chunks with a custom link type |
#### `filename`
Type: `String|Function`
Default: `[name].css`
This option determines the name of each output CSS file.
Works like [`output.filename`](https://webpack.js.org/configuration/output/#outputfilename)
#### `chunkFilename`
Type: `String|Function`
Default: `based on filename`
> i Specifying `chunkFilename` as a `function` is only available in webpack@5
This option determines the name of non-entry chunk files.
Works like [`output.chunkFilename`](https://webpack.js.org/configuration/output/#outputchunkfilename)
#### `ignoreOrder`
Type: `Boolean`
Default: `false`
Remove Order Warnings.
See [examples](#remove-order-warnings) below for details.
#### `insert`
Type: `String|Function`
Default: `document.head.appendChild(linkTag);`
By default, the `mini-css-extract-plugin` appends styles (`<link>` elements) to `document.head` of the current `window`.
However in some circumstances it might be necessary to have finer control over the append target or even delay `link` elements instertion.
For example this is the case when you asynchronously load styles for an application that runs inside of an iframe.
In such cases `insert` can be configured to be a function or a custom selector.
If you target an [iframe](https://developer.mozilla.org/en-US/docs/Web/API/HTMLIFrameElement) make sure that the parent document has sufficient access rights to reach into the frame document and append elements to it.
##### `String`
Allows to setup custom [query selector](https://developer.mozilla.org/en-US/docs/Web/API/Document/querySelector).
A new `<link>` element will be inserted after the found item.
**webpack.config.js**
```js
new MiniCssExtractPlugin({
insert: '#some-element',
});
```
A new `<link>` element will be inserted after the element with id `some-element`.
##### `Function`
Allows to override default behavior and insert styles at any position.
> ⚠ Do not forget that this code will run in the browser alongside your application. Since not all browsers support latest ECMA features like `let`, `const`, `arrow function expression` and etc we recommend you to use only ECMA 5 features and syntax.
> > ⚠ The `insert` function is serialized to string and passed to the plugin. This means that it won't have access to the scope of the webpack configuration module.
**webpack.config.js**
```js
new MiniCssExtractPlugin({
insert: function (linkTag) {
var reference = document.querySelector('#some-element');
if (reference) {
reference.parentNode.insertBefore(linkTag, reference);
}
},
});
```
A new `<link>` element will be inserted before the element with id `some-element`.
#### `attributes`
Type: `Object`
Default: `{}`
If defined, the `mini-css-extract-plugin` will attach given attributes with their values on <link> element.
**webpack.config.js**
```js
const MiniCssExtractPlugin = require('mini-css-extract-plugin');
module.exports = {
plugins: [
new MiniCssExtractPlugin({
attributes: {
id: 'target',
'data-target': 'example',
},
}),
],
module: {
rules: [
{
test: /\.css$/i,
use: [MiniCssExtractPlugin.loader, 'css-loader'],
},
],
},
};
```
Note: It's only applied to dynamically loaded css chunks, if you want to modify link attributes inside html file, please using [html-webpack-plugin](https://github.com/jantimon/html-webpack-plugin)

#### `esModule`
Type: `Boolean`
Default: `true`
By default, `mini-css-extract-plugin` generates JS modules that use the ES modules syntax.
There are some cases in which using ES modules is beneficial, like in the case of [module concatenation](https://webpack.js.org/plugins/module-concatenation-plugin/) and [tree shaking](https://webpack.js.org/guides/tree-shaking/).
You can enable a CommonJS syntax using:
**webpack.config.js**
```js
const MiniCssExtractPlugin = require('mini-css-extract-plugin');
module.exports = {
plugins: [new MiniCssExtractPlugin()],
module: {
rules: [
{
test: /\.css$/i,
use: [
{
loader: MiniCssExtractPlugin.loader,
options: {
esModule: false,
},
},
'css-loader',
],
},
],
},
};
```

### Common use case
`mini-css-extract-plugin` is more often used in `production` mode to get separate css files.
For `development` mode (including `webpack-dev-server`) you can use `style-loader`, because it injects CSS into the DOM using multiple <style></style> and works faster.
> i Do not use together `style-loader` and `mini-css-extract-plugin`.
**webpack.config.js**
```js
const MiniCssExtractPlugin = require('mini-css-extract-plugin');
const devMode = process.env.NODE_ENV !== 'production';
const plugins = [];
if (!devMode) {
// enable in production only
plugins.push(new MiniCssExtractPlugin());
}
module.exports = {
plugins,
module: {
rules: [
{
test: /\.(sa|sc|c)ss$/,
use: [
devMode ? 'style-loader' : MiniCssExtractPlugin.loader,
'css-loader',
'postcss-loader',
'sass-loader',
],
},
],
},
};
```

### Using preloaded or inlined CSS
The runtime code detects already added CSS via `<link>` or `<style>` tag.
This can be useful when injecting CSS on server-side for Server-Side-Rendering.
The `href` of the `<link>` tag has to match the URL that will be used for loading the CSS chunk.
The `data-href` attribute can be used for `<link>` and `<style>` too.
When inlining CSS `data-href` must be used.
### Extracting all CSS in a single file
The CSS can be extracted in one CSS file using `optimization.splitChunks.cacheGroups`.
**webpack.config.js**
```js
const MiniCssExtractPlugin = require('mini-css-extract-plugin');
module.exports = {
optimization: {
splitChunks: {
cacheGroups: {
styles: {
name: 'styles',
type: 'css/mini-extract',
// For webpack@4
// test: /\.css$/,
chunks: 'all',
enforce: true,
},
},
},
},
plugins: [
new MiniCssExtractPlugin({
filename: '[name].css',
}),
],
module: {
rules: [
{
test: /\.css$/,
use: [MiniCssExtractPlugin.loader, 'css-loader'],
},
],
},
};
```

### Remove Order Warnings
For projects where css ordering has been mitigated through consistent use of scoping or naming conventions, the css order warnings can be disabled by setting the ignoreOrder flag to true for the plugin.
**webpack.config.js**
```js
const MiniCssExtractPlugin = require('mini-css-extract-plugin');
module.exports = {
plugins: [
new MiniCssExtractPlugin({
ignoreOrder: true,
}),
],
module: {
rules: [
{
test: /\.css$/i,
use: [MiniCssExtractPlugin.loader, 'css-loader'],
},
],
},
};
```

# loader-utils
## Methods
### `getOptions`
Recommended way to retrieve the options of a loader invocation:
```javascript
// inside your loader
const options = loaderUtils.getOptions(this);
```
1. If `this.query` is a string:
- Tries to parse the query string and returns a new object
- Throws if it's not a valid query string
2. If `this.query` is object-like, it just returns `this.query`
3. In any other case, it just returns `null`
**Please note:** The returned `options` object is *read-only*. It may be re-used across multiple invocations.
If you pass it on to another library, make sure to make a *deep copy* of it:
```javascript
const options = Object.assign(
{},
defaultOptions,
loaderUtils.getOptions(this) // it is safe to pass null to Object.assign()
);
// don't forget nested objects or arrays
options.obj = Object.assign({}, options.obj);
options.arr = options.arr.slice();
someLibrary(options);
```
[clone](https://www.npmjs.com/package/clone) is a good library to make a deep copy of the options.
#### Options as query strings
If the loader options have been passed as loader query string (`loader?some&params`), the string is parsed by using [`parseQuery`](#parsequery).
### `parseQuery`
Parses a passed string (e.g. `loaderContext.resourceQuery`) as a query string, and returns an object.
``` javascript
const params = loaderUtils.parseQuery(this.resourceQuery); // resource: `file?param1=foo`
if (params.param1 === "foo") {
// do something
}
```
The string is parsed like this:
``` text
-> Error
? -> {}
?flag -> { flag: true }
?+flag -> { flag: true }
?-flag -> { flag: false }
?xyz=test -> { xyz: "test" }
?xyz=1 -> { xyz: "1" } // numbers are NOT parsed
?xyz[]=a -> { xyz: ["a"] }
?flag1&flag2 -> { flag1: true, flag2: true }
?+flag1,-flag2 -> { flag1: true, flag2: false }
?xyz[]=a,xyz[]=b -> { xyz: ["a", "b"] }
?a%2C%26b=c%2C%26d -> { "a,&b": "c,&d" }
?{data:{a:1},isJSON5:true} -> { data: { a: 1 }, isJSON5: true }
```
### `stringifyRequest`
Turns a request into a string that can be used inside `require()` or `import` while avoiding absolute paths.
Use it instead of `JSON.stringify(...)` if you're generating code inside a loader.
**Why is this necessary?** Since webpack calculates the hash before module paths are translated into module ids, we must avoid absolute paths to ensure
consistent hashes across different compilations.
This function:
- resolves absolute requests into relative requests if the request and the module are on the same hard drive
- replaces `\` with `/` if the request and the module are on the same hard drive
- won't change the path at all if the request and the module are on different hard drives
- applies `JSON.stringify` to the result
```javascript
loaderUtils.stringifyRequest(this, "./test.js");
// "\"./test.js\""
loaderUtils.stringifyRequest(this, ".\\test.js");
// "\"./test.js\""
loaderUtils.stringifyRequest(this, "test");
// "\"test\""
loaderUtils.stringifyRequest(this, "test/lib/index.js");
// "\"test/lib/index.js\""
loaderUtils.stringifyRequest(this, "otherLoader?andConfig!test?someConfig");
// "\"otherLoader?andConfig!test?someConfig\""
loaderUtils.stringifyRequest(this, require.resolve("test"));
// "\"../node_modules/some-loader/lib/test.js\""
loaderUtils.stringifyRequest(this, "C:\\module\\test.js");
// "\"../../test.js\"" (on Windows, in case the module and the request are on the same drive)
loaderUtils.stringifyRequest(this, "C:\\module\\test.js");
// "\"C:\\module\\test.js\"" (on Windows, in case the module and the request are on different drives)
loaderUtils.stringifyRequest(this, "\\\\network-drive\\test.js");
// "\"\\\\network-drive\\\\test.js\"" (on Windows, in case the module and the request are on different drives)
```
### `urlToRequest`
Converts some resource URL to a webpack module request.
> i Before call `urlToRequest` you need call `isUrlRequest` to ensure it is requestable url
```javascript
const url = "path/to/module.js";
if (loaderUtils.isUrlRequest(url)) {
// Logic for requestable url
const request = loaderUtils.urlToRequest(url);
} else {
// Logic for not requestable url
}
```
Simple example:
```javascript
const url = "path/to/module.js";
const request = loaderUtils.urlToRequest(url); // "./path/to/module.js"
```
#### Module URLs
Any URL containing a `~` will be interpreted as a module request. Anything after the `~` will be considered the request path.
```javascript
const url = "~path/to/module.js";
const request = loaderUtils.urlToRequest(url); // "path/to/module.js"
```
#### Root-relative URLs
URLs that are root-relative (start with `/`) can be resolved relative to some arbitrary path by using the `root` parameter:
```javascript
const url = "/path/to/module.js";
const root = "./root";
const request = loaderUtils.urlToRequest(url, root); // "./root/path/to/module.js"
```
To convert a root-relative URL into a module URL, specify a `root` value that starts with `~`:
```javascript
const url = "/path/to/module.js";
const root = "~";
const request = loaderUtils.urlToRequest(url, root); // "path/to/module.js"
```
### `interpolateName`
Interpolates a filename template using multiple placeholders and/or a regular expression.
The template and regular expression are set as query params called `name` and `regExp` on the current loader's context.
```javascript
const interpolatedName = loaderUtils.interpolateName(loaderContext, name, options);
```
The following tokens are replaced in the `name` parameter:
* `[ext]` the extension of the resource
* `[name]` the basename of the resource
* `[path]` the path of the resource relative to the `context` query parameter or option.
* `[folder]` the folder the resource is in
* `[query]` the queryof the resource, i.e. `?foo=bar`
* `[emoji]` a random emoji representation of `options.content`
* `[emoji:<length>]` same as above, but with a customizable number of emojis
* `[contenthash]` the hash of `options.content` (Buffer) (by default it's the hex digest of the md4 hash)
* `[<hashType>:contenthash:<digestType>:<length>]` optionally one can configure
* other `hashType`s, i. e. `sha1`, `md4`, `md5`, `sha256`, `sha512`
* other `digestType`s, i. e. `hex`, `base26`, `base32`, `base36`, `base49`, `base52`, `base58`, `base62`, `base64`
* and `length` the length in chars
* `[hash]` the hash of `options.content` (Buffer) (by default it's the hex digest of the md4 hash)
* `[<hashType>:hash:<digestType>:<length>]` optionally one can configure
* other `hashType`s, i. e. `sha1`, `md4`, `md5`, `sha256`, `sha512`
* other `digestType`s, i. e. `hex`, `base26`, `base32`, `base36`, `base49`, `base52`, `base58`, `base62`, `base64`
* and `length` the length in chars
* `[N]` the N-th match obtained from matching the current file name against `options.regExp`
In loader context `[hash]` and `[contenthash]` are the same, but we recommend using `[contenthash]` for avoid misleading.

# schema-utils
Package for validate options in loaders and plugins.
## Getting Started
To begin, you'll need to install `schema-utils`:
```console
npm install schema-utils
```
## API
**schema.json**
```json
{
"type": "object",
"properties": {
"option": {
"type": "boolean"
}
},
"additionalProperties": false
}
```
```js
import schema from './path/to/schema.json';
import { validate } from 'schema-utils';
const options = { option: true };
const configuration = { name: 'Loader Name/Plugin Name/Name' };
validate(schema, options, configuration);
```
### `schema`
Type: `String`
JSON schema.
Simple example of schema:
```json
{
"type": "object",
"properties": {
"name": {
"description": "This is description of option.",
"type": "string"
}
},
"additionalProperties": false
}
```
### `options`
Type: `Object`
Object with options.
```js
import schema from './path/to/schema.json';
import { validate } from 'schema-utils';
const options = { foo: 'bar' };
validate(schema, { name: 123 }, { name: 'MyPlugin' });
```
### `configuration`
Allow to configure validator.
There is an alternative method to configure the `name` and`baseDataPath` options via the `title` property in the schema.
For example:
```json
{
"title": "My Loader options",
"type": "object",
"properties": {
"name": {
"description": "This is description of option.",
"type": "string"
}
},
"additionalProperties": false
}
```
The last word used for the `baseDataPath` option, other words used for the `name` option.
Based on the example above the `name` option equals `My Loader`, the `baseDataPath` option equals `options`.
#### `name`
Type: `Object`
Default: `"Object"`
Allow to setup name in validation errors.
```js
import schema from './path/to/schema.json';
import { validate } from 'schema-utils';
const options = { foo: 'bar' };
validate(schema, options, { name: 'MyPlugin' });
```
```shell
Invalid configuration object. MyPlugin has been initialised using a configuration object that does not match the API schema.
- configuration.optionName should be a integer.
```
#### `baseDataPath`
Type: `String`
Default: `"configuration"`
Allow to setup base data path in validation errors.
```js
import schema from './path/to/schema.json';
import { validate } from 'schema-utils';
const options = { foo: 'bar' };
validate(schema, options, { name: 'MyPlugin', baseDataPath: 'options' });
```
```shell
Invalid options object. MyPlugin has been initialised using an options object that does not match the API schema.
- options.optionName should be a integer.
```
#### `postFormatter`
Type: `Function`
Default: `undefined`
Allow to reformat errors.
```js
import schema from './path/to/schema.json';
import { validate } from 'schema-utils';
const options = { foo: 'bar' };
validate(schema, options, {
name: 'MyPlugin',
postFormatter: (formattedError, error) => {
if (error.keyword === 'type') {
return `${formattedError}\nAdditional Information.`;
}
return formattedError;
},
});
```
```shell
Invalid options object. MyPlugin has been initialized using an options object that does not match the API schema.
- options.optionName should be a integer.
Additional Information.
```
